What?! No, I just don't like slow rock like that. I find nothing special about this band. Sure, songs can have meaning, and some songs have great meaning. However, if a song only has meaning and nothing to get engrossed in, why would I listen to it? I listen to music to be immersed and excited at the same time. My music of choice is usually UK hardcore or gabber, which is basically electronic music with a 4/4 beat and extreme synths at a constant 170-200 BPM and sometimes faster. I also listen to breakcore sometimes, which is very irregular and artistic electronic music with heavy drum machine experimentation and a sometimes irregular time signature. As far as rock and related stuff is concerned, I like it experimental. I usually don't go for "regular" rock (which is what I consider this, along with practically anything that is labeled "alternative"), but sometimes I'll listen to progressive rock, since some of it is quite experimental. I like to listen to music from all over the world, but in doing so I realized that my least favorite type of music (besides gangsta rap) is American mainstream rock. These people might not be a mainstream band, but I cannot find a single thing about them that makes them stand out from the crowd. They're not bad...they're just not great, in my opinion.
